Converse All AtarWith the NBA season tipping off this week, why not the time-honored Converse All Star to lead off this week’s digest? (Pause for pre-teen nostalgia moment…)

  • Matticus gets the ball rolling (bouncing?) this week with his essay on properly PUGging raids. At this moment in time, the idea of answering "LF Priest for Kara then we’re GTG" gives me the heebie-jeebies. But if I ever get the courage (or am nuts enough) to answer that call, Matt’s article will be one I’m glad I’ve read.
  • Over at Altitis, Gwaendar has a spirited rant against those who demand that "such-and-such overpowered class" be nerfed down to the whiners’ level. She makes an especially good point that Blizzard’s general policy has been anti-nerf, instead preferring to buff weaker classes. Hear hear!
  • The EgoTank grabbed Tuesday’s spotlight from The Egotistical Priest to let us in on some Tanking Tidbits. Must-read for tanks, and a good read for other raiders, just to give some additional perspective on what your tank can, or should be able to do.
  • Ego grabbed a share of the spotlight herself, however, with her Thursday essay on WoW Web Stats. Read this article. Now.  Go…shoo! We’ll be here when you get back. …

Okay…now you’re ready for…

  • In one of his more extreme Priestly Endeavors, Kirk is opening the window on WowWebStats, the preeminent combat logging and analysis tool for raiders. This is the first of a series of "how-to" articles on WWS. The linked article is the first in the series. Read ‘em all!
  • Lassirra over at The Hunter’s Mark is at it again with a how-to on enchants for Hunters. I have this article triple-tagged in Google Reader for a detailed examination.
  • Proving once again why hers is such a great blog, Phaelia at Resto4Life gave a great answer to a question on how to choose a (Druid) healing spec. But the wisdom can be applied to any spec choice.
